Output dd087d12d915c64cffa0fb4ca3b8c8d262ce76c0ff6f426615cafbcff2828008:23

value
199950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ab6a9834caceee48855551299e634714f22fa819 OP_EQUAL
address
3HKPAfbjyY7N9E4J8Yid6T6zjr44yUarWS
transaction
dd087d12d915c64cffa0fb4ca3b8c8d262ce76c0ff6f426615cafbcff2828008
spent
true